The move came after initial reports indicated Huang had not been invited to the high-profile trip.
According to the source, Trump called Huang after seeing media coverage of the Nvidia CEO’s absence from the delegation. Huang then flew to Alaska to board Air Force One, joining more than a dozen other U.S. executives traveling to Beijing this week. Trump is scheduled to meet with Chinese President Xi Jinping on Thursday and Friday, local time.
“Jensen is attending the summit at the invitation of President Trump to support America and the administration’s goals,” a spokesperson for Nvidia said in a statement. The chip giant referred to the same comment when asked about Huang joining mid-journey in Alaska but did not provide a reason for the sudden change.
The White House did not immediately respond to a request for comment on the matter.
In a social media post, Trump confirmed that Huang was onboard Air Force One and denied earlier reports that the Nvidia CEO had not been invited. The president’s post did not elaborate further on the circumstances.
The trip represents a significant diplomatic and business engagement, with Trump bringing senior U.S. executives to discuss trade and technology issues with Chinese leadership. Nvidia, a leading semiconductor company, has faced heightened scrutiny in U.S.-China trade relations, particularly regarding chip exports.

Huang’s presence suggests the administration may prioritize semiconductor supply chain discussions during the meetings with Chinese leadership.
Industry observers note that Nvidia has been a central figure in export control debates, with the company’s advanced chips subject to restrictions aimed at limiting China’s access to cutting-edge AI technology. Huang’s participation could signal potential shifts or clarifications in policy stance, though no specific outcomes have been confirmed.
The personal intervention by Trump to include Huang highlights the CEO’s unique position in both technology and geopolitical spheres. It also reflects the fluid nature of high-level business-government engagements, where media coverage can influence decisions in real time.
For investors, the development adds a layer of uncertainty around trade negotiations and potential regulatory changes affecting the semiconductor sector. While the immediate impact on Nvidia’s operations remains unclear, the company’s direct access to the administration during critical talks may be viewed as a positive sign for its ability to navigate complex trade environments.
